Miller Child Development Center Inc
Miller Child Development Center Inc is a Human Services Organizations company at San Antonio,Texas,United States , Tel is (210)225-7596,address is 229 Saint John.You can find more Miller Child Development Center Inc contact info like fax,email,website below.